- Company Name
- Intellectt Inc
- Job Title
- Computer Vision Resource
- Job Description
-
**Job Title:** Computer Vision Engineer
**Role Summary:**
Design, develop, and optimize computer vision solutions for real‑time and embedded applications. Lead technical problem solving, prototype design, and code integration while collaborating with cross‑functional teams to deliver quality products.
**Expectations:**
- 3+ years of hands‑on experience in computer vision, image/video processing, or related domain.
- Proficient in Python, C/C++11+, and familiar with Java.
- Bachelor’s degree in computer engineering/computer science with emphasis on computer vision or machine learning.
- Deep understanding of machine learning/deep learning for vision tasks.
- Experience with relevant vision domains (object detection, tracking, tracking & recognition, multiple‑view geometry, OCR, camera calibration, 3D processing, SfM/SLAM, activity recognition).
- Preference for Android CV experience, knowledge of OpenCV, TensorFlow, and PyTorch.
- Comfortable with parallel and vectorized computing.
- Strong software design principles and Agile workflow familiarity.
**Key Responsibilities:**
- Develop and maintain high‑performance CV algorithms and libraries in C++ and Python.
- Integrate CV modules into production pipelines and mobile/embedded platforms.
- Optimize models for speed, memory, and energy efficiency (vectorization, GPU/CPU parallelism).
- Validate and benchmark vision systems against accuracy, latency, and robustness metrics.
- Collaborate with product and software teams to translate business requirements into technical specifications.
- Document design decisions, performance outcomes, and best practices.
**Required Skills:**
- Programming: Python, C, C++11+, Java (optional).
- CV frameworks: OpenCV; ML frameworks: TensorFlow, PyTorch.
- Algorithms: object detection, tracking, OCR, camera calibration, 3D SfM/SLAM, activity recognition.
- Parallel/vector computing, performance profiling.
- Software design, architecture, unit testing, version control (Git).
- Agile/Scrum methodology.
**Required Education & Certifications:**
- Bachelor’s degree in Computer Engineering, Computer Science, or related field (specialization in CV/ML preferred).
- No mandatory certifications; relevant coursework or proven project portfolio acceptable.
Holtsville, United states
On site
Junior
03-12-2025